Request Detailed Siding Cost Estimates With All Services Included
The foundation of avoiding hidden fees begins with obtaining comprehensive, itemized cost estimates from any siding contractor you're considering.
Legitimate estimates should clearly break down materials, labor, removal of existing siding, disposal fees, trim work, and any necessary repairs to the underlying structure. Vague, single-number quotes without these details make it impossible to compare options accurately.
Request that contractors specify the exact materials being used, including brand names, product lines, and quality grades. This transparency prevents later substitutions with inferior products.

Beware Of These Common Hidden Siding Installation Fees
Several tactics appear repeatedly among less reputable siding contractors. Learning to recognize these patterns helps you avoid companies that employ them.
Watch for undefined "preparation fees" added after work begins. While legitimate preparation work exists, these costs should be included in your initial estimate unless truly unforeseeable conditions are discovered.
Be cautious of contractors charging separate fees for removing and disposing of old siding. This fundamental step belongs in your base quote, not as an additional line item discovered later.
Question any significant charges for "structural repairs" identified after work begins. Reputable contractors include a thorough inspection before providing estimates, noting likely repair needs upfront.
Protect Yourself With Clear Contract Terms For Siding Services
The contract you sign ultimately governs your project costs. Several specific elements help prevent unexpected charges.
Ensure your contract includes a detailed scope of work that specifically lists all services covered by your quoted price. This documentation prevents disagreements about what was included.
Look for "change order" provisions that require your written approval before any additional work or charges are added to your project. This prevents surprise billing for allegedly necessary add-ons.
Verify that payment terms are clearly structured, typically with deposits of no more than 30% and remaining payments tied to completion of specific project milestones rather than calendar dates.
Questions To Ask Roofing And Siding Companies About
Extra Charges
Direct questions about potential fee scenarios help clarify expectations before you sign a contract.
Ask specifically: "What additional charges might arise during my project, and under what circumstances?" The answer reveals much about a company's transparency and business practices.
Inquire about how unforeseen issues are handled. Reputable contractors explain their discovery process and how they communicate necessary changes before proceeding with additional work.
Request clarification about what happens if you're not satisfied with certain aspects of the installation. Quality siding contractors include satisfaction guarantees without charging extra for reasonable adjustments.
